Abstract
本文提出了一种计算圆柱形永磁涡流耦合器在圆柱坐标系下特性的解析方法。针对耦合器的简化圆柱形结构,建立了二维/三维电磁场解析模型,预测了磁场分布、电流密度分布和转矩输出特性。将结果与有限元模型的结果进行比较,发现误差小于5%。通过比较圆柱坐标系和笛卡尔坐标系计算的扭矩输出特性,发现圆柱坐标系中的解析方法精度更高。在典型工作条件下,考虑到温度校正,3D分析模型的扭矩输出特性与实验原型测试结果进行了比较,误差也小于5%。因此,这种方法允许准确、快速地设计圆柱形永磁涡流耦合器。
Keywords
2D/3D analytical models,eddy current,cylindrical-type,Cylindrical coordinate system,,torque
